WebMar 9, 2014 · The back has three natural curves: a slight forward curve in the neck (cervical curve), a slight backward curve in the upper back (thoracic curve) and a slight forward curve in the low back (lumbar curve). When these curves are in proper alignment, the spine, shoulders, hips, knees, and ankles are in balance, and body weight is evenly distributed. WebYour natural spine curvature looks like an “S” because this shape provides added shock absorption and movement, much like the curvature of a spring can redistribute weight and offer shock absorption. Children are born with more of a “C” curved spine, but the spine naturally takes on a curved “S” shape as we develop. ...
